Oil Filter
Like this. Packard Purolator EF 2 1930 factory oil filter
The original oil filter was a Purolator EF-2, a disposable canister type of bypass filter. There is a modern unit that externally matches the EF-2 but accepts a modern, spin-on filter inside.
